Write an equation (a) in standard form and (b) in slope-intercept form for the line described.
through (10,4), parallel to y = -9

y=4

Step-by-step explanation:

if 2 lines are parallel their slopes are identical

so the slope of the line parallel to the given line is 0

y-4=0(x-10) y=4
